Cost

Costs for replacing glass panes are determined by numerous factors. For instance the thickness of the glass and the size of the window, the type of glass as well as the brand of glass, and the condition of the frame all play a part in the total cost. It is essential to determine the cost of replacing the frames or insulate the window. For homeowners who wish to replace their windows, this could be an additional expense.

Single-pane glass window replacement cost can vary from $50 up to $200. Triple-pane and double-pane windows on the other hand are more expensive than a single-pane windows.

It is best to call an expert to replace damaged windows. A handyman in your neighborhood will charge you about $252 for a square 24 inches window. The labor will be included. Depending on the severity of damage, you may have to pay more than this.

It may be beneficial in some circumstances to call at least three or four local window companies. They'll be able offer you a range of estimates and help you choose the most suitable option. Window Repair jobs require mobilization time. This could range from a few hours up to a full day. The triple pane window is another type of insulated glass. These windows come with three panes, each of which has an inert gas separate to each. These gases ensure your home is warm in winter and cool in summer. They also block UV radiations from entering your home.

Typically these insulated glass units are constructed with a thickness of 3-10mm. The thickness of the glass as well as the grid's size can impact the cost. The size of the window can also impact the price. These insulated windows typically cost about $10 per square foot.
